Laboratory Shift Technician

Location: Aston, Birmingham

Salary: £34,500 per annum (including shift allowance)

Hours: Rotating shifts – 6:00am to 2:00pm / 2:00pm to 10:00pm / 10:00pm to 6:00am



About the Role

We are seeking a motivated and detail-oriented Laboratory Shift Technician to join our team in Aston, Birmingham. Reporting to the Senior Laboratory Technician, you will be responsible for carrying out a wide range of laboratory testing, equipment verification, solution analysis, and quality assurance activities to ensure products meet customer specifications and company standards.



The role also includes providing operational cover for shift management during nights and weekends when required.



Key Responsibilities

Verification of Mechanical & Chemical Properties


  • Hardness testing

  • Tensile testing

  • Bend testing

  • Spring bend testing

  • Grain size determination

  • Spectrographic chemical analysis

  • Various supplementary tests as required

  • Generation of Certificates of Conformity



Verification & Maintenance of Test Equipment


  • Routine calibration checks of hardness testers, tensometer and spectrographs

  • Daily maintenance of the Spectrolux Container Laboratory

  • Maintenance of laboratory equipment as required



Routine Solution Checks


  • Verification of acid tank strengths and recommending additions

  • Verification of degreaser tank strengths and recommending additions

  • Verification of benzotriazole strengths and recommending additions



Structural Analysis


  • Routine macrosections of cast structures

  • Microsectioning and polishing as required



Inspection of Incoming Raw Materials


  • Inspection and testing of virgin and scrap materials



Shift Management Cover

When required to cover night shifts and weekends, responsibilities include:




  • Full responsibility for plant operations

  • Ensuring health, safety and environmental requirements are adhered to at all times

  • Maintaining high quality standards throughout the manufacturing process

  • Prioritising jobs and workloads

  • Managing staffing levels across manufacturing operations
